New active galactic nuclei among the INTEGRAL and SWIFT X-ray sources

Abstract: Abstract-We present the results of our optical identifications of a set of X-ray sources from the INTE-GRAL and SWIFT all-sky surveys. The optical data have been obtained with the 1.5-m Russian-Turkish Telescope (RTT-150). Nine X-ray sources have been identified with active galactic nuclei (AGNs). Two of them are located in the nearby spiral galaxies MCG-01-05-047 and NGC 973 seen almost edge-on. One source, IGR J16562-3301, is probably a BL Lac object (blazar). “…The IR source 2MASS J180438.92−145647.4 has been identified by the INTEGRAL Galactic survey as a hard, X‐ray‐bright source of interest. Two optical investigations have followed, first by Burenin et al (2006) who identify the counterpart as a massive star and then by Masetti et al (2008) who identify it as a low‐mass star. The latter assume that the extinction of 3 mag from optical line ratios is incorrect due to the large inferred distances that would result and instead determine a distance of ∼7 kpc (based on the Galactic colour excess).…”
